Studi Kasus No Bleed pada APU Pesawat Boeing 737-800
Abstract
Auxillary Power Unit (APU) is small gas turbine engine that serves as pneumatic and electrical supply. Pneumatic supply originates from bleed air system in APU. Pneumatic supply by APU is used for main engine start, air conditioning, and pressurization. According to the pilot's report, one of the problems that often occur in APU was no APU bleed that could be seen from the absence of air pressure indicator in the cockpit, hence APU was unable to supply pneumatic for aircraft. As a consequence, an analysis was conducted to find out the cause and how to resolve cases of no APU bleed. The methods used were literature studies, observations, and consultations. The data was then analyzed using fishbone diagrams to identify and find the cause of no APU bleed cases. Based on the results of the analysis, no APU bleed can occur due to three main factors, consisting of wiring damage, bleed air valve, and delta pressure sensor. These factors caused starting engine process to be hampered. In order to overcome this problem, inspection can be done on APU wire harness, removal delta pressure sensor, and removal of bleed air valve
